Ticket: Turnstile upgrade — east lobby, Marbeck House

Hi team assistants — heads up that the east lobby turnstiles are being swapped out Thursday and Friday as part of the Lanternworks refresh. Expect some drilling noise and a fenced-off lane. Badges won't scan on the old units once they're powered down, so steer your visitors to the west entrance. If someone absolutely must use the east side, the temporary gate accepts the code below.

staff pass of kagup-fajog = bdg-QCHVQW-99665837

TileRunner prefetches map tiles for the Harbrook coverage zones. Support handles restarts only; do not change zone lists without a ticket to the Meridian Maps team.

Copy `prefetch.env.sample` to `prefetch.env` on the worker host. Set `TILE_ZONE=harbrook-north`, `PREFETCH_CONCURRENCY=4`, and `CACHE_DIR=/var/tilerunner/cache`. Leave `RETRY_BACKOFF_MS` at the default unless instructed.

The upstream tile service requires authentication for every fetch batch. Add the tile service credential on the next line of prefetch.env.

env line for baduf-hahog: RELAY_SECRET3=c4a

Facilities Ticket — Cleaning Crew Access, Brindle Annex

For new starters handling evening lock-up: the Sorano Cleaning crew arrives nightly at 21:30 via the annex side door. Check their rota sheet, note arrival in the log, and ensure the storeroom is relocked afterward. To let them through the side door, enter the access code below.

badge for yaweg-hafog: bdg-GX-6

## Sensor drift: what to do at 3am

If the GrowLoop controller starts reporting humidity swings that don't match the backup probes in the Fernwick greenhouse, it's almost always sensor drift, not an actual climate event. Don't panic and don't touch the vents manually. First, restart the calibration daemon and give it ten minutes to re-baseline. If readings still disagree by more than 5%, flip the controller into safe mode. The safe-mode thresholds it will use are these.

config for yahap-bajof:
[istix]
host = istix.qorvelsys.internal
user = istix_svc
database = istix_prod